Food is never going out of style. Here is an update of our community Agroforestry project located in Hawaii, Kauai. Created by Paul Massey of Regeneration 501(c)(3) non-profit, supported by a handful of stewards with the inputs of hundreds of volunteers pouring thousands of hours of love/effort.
